Did you know that healthy eating is better than dieting for successful, long-term weight loss? In fact, in order to create a long-term healthy lifestyle for yourself, you need to ditch those diets! Dieting is a short-term 'solution' to a lifelong 'problem'. After all, we need to eat three times a day for the rest of our lives. So, if you are serious about your health and your weight, you need to think about how you can eat healthily, three times every day, for the rest of your life!

Many of these diet products and systems actually cause you to put on weight once you stop using them. They have nothing to do with healthy eating. Whether it is the 'cabbage soup' method, or some powdered mixture, these diets are based on food that is pretty repulsive, so that you eat very little of it. Therefore, you are not taking in sufficient calories for your body to function normally.
Your body is programmed by evolution to panic in this situation and goes into 'starvation mode'. This means that you burn muscle, not the fat you want to lose! Then your entire metabolism slows down in order to preserve what energy your body still holds in its fat reserves. Then, when you come off the diet and go back to normal eating, you pile on the weight because your metabolism is slower than it should be.
You may mistake this for meaning that the diet worked, because you put on weight when you stopped it. And so you become hooked on yo-yo dieting, never really sorting out a healthy eating lifestyle that you can live with day in day out.

To lose weight and keep it off permanently, it is much better to build a healthy eating lifestyle for yourself that you can stick to, for the rest of your life, not just the immediate future.
Have a good breakfast so you don't snack during the day. Cut out fatty sugary treat foods and snack on seeds, nuts and fruit. Bulk up your meals with lots of healthy veggies. Switch to wholegrain breads, cereals, pastas etc. These will fill you up quicker than the white, refined ones, which have a habit of going straight to your waistline and piling on tummy weight! Cut out take-outs and ready-meals. Learn how to cook some basic quick and easy healthy meals and get into the routine of preparing your own food. Make exercise part of your everyday life. And finally, be happy and don't obsess about food. Food and healthy eating should be a normal, natural part of life, not something we do to extremes and endlessly think about!
